TypeScript的安装和编译

70 阅读1分钟

安装TypeScript

  • npm i -g typescript全局安装tsc命令,或在项目中使用npm i typescript为单独项目安装

初始化tsconfig.json配置文件

官方配置文档

  • tsc --init会自动生成一个配置文件,可以修改严格模式和报错处理等配置。

常见的配置

  • ”strict“: true是否开启严格模式
  • ”target“: es2015编译成指定js的规范版本也可直接用版本号如es6
  • ”noEmitOnError“: true是否开启没有错误提示时才编译成js

编译

手动编译成js

  • tsc index.ts将指定ts文件编译成js

自动编译成js(热更新)

  • 会自动监听ts文件的变化而实时编译成js
  • tsc --watch监听文件夹下的所有ts文件变化并自动编译成js
  • tsc --watch index.ts监听指定ts文件并自动编译成js
  • tsc --watch可以缩写成tsc -w
  • tsc --noEmitOnError --watch开启没有报错提示时才自动编译成js(不推荐使用,最好在tsconfig.json中进行配置)